Hailin Gu Minghou Liu Xinlong Li Hongjie Huang Yiqiang Wu Feiyang Sun 《Flow, Turbulence and Combustion》2018,101(3):719-740
The unsteadiness of the flow over a surface-mounted rib involving passive scalar transport is studied using large-eddy simulation (LES) at a Reynolds number of 3000 (based on the rib height, \(h\), and the free-stream velocity, \(U_{0})\). The purpose of the present study is to gain further insight into the physical origin of the flow instability and its effect on passive scalar transport. Fourier spectral analysis of the velocity at different positions suggests that, in addition to the K-H instability in the shear layer (St ≈?0.42), two lower frequencies (St ≈?0.06 and 0.09) also exist. It is observed that the low-frequency instabilities accompany the shedding process of vortical structures. One low frequency, at \(\text {St}\approx 0.06\), is related to the pumping motion of the recirculation bubble, while the other, at \(\text {St}\approx 0.09\), is associated with the flapping mode of the shear layer. Through comparisons of velocity and temperature fields and the spectra of scalar fluctuations, it is found that the passive scalar is transported by the convection of vortical structures. 相似文献

本文系统疏理了重积分的对称性,从重积分的换元法出发,给出了几种常用对称性的数学原理,并通过一些算例展示了这些对称性在简化重积分计算方面所发挥的重要作用. 相似文献

Yiqiang Zhou 《代数通讯》2013,41(5):1997-2001
Abstract The two main classes of finite dimensional composition algebras, Hurwitz and symmetric, are characterized in terms of the flexible identity, and even of the third power associative identity, over fields of arbitrary characteristic. 相似文献

Motivated by applications in manufacturing systems and computer networks, in this paper, we consider a tandem queue with feedback.
In this model, the i.i.d. interarrival times and the i.i.d. service times are both exponential and independent. Upon completion
of a service at the second station, the customer either leaves the system with probability p or goes back, together with all customers currently waiting in the second queue, to the first queue with probability 1−p. For any fixed number of customers in one queue (either queue 1 or queue 2), using newly developed methods we study properties
of the exactly geometric tail asymptotics as the number of customers in the other queue increases to infinity. We hope that
this work can serve as a demonstration of how to deal with a block generating function of GI/M/1 type, and an illustration
of how the boundary behaviour can affect the tail decay rate. 相似文献

Partially linear model is a class of commonly
used semiparametric models, this paper focus on variable selection
and parameter estimation for partially linear models via adaptive
LASSO method. Firstly, based on profile least squares and adaptive
LASSO method, the adaptive LASSO estimator for partially linear
models are constructed, and the selections of penalty parameter and
bandwidth are discussed. Under some regular conditions, the
consistency and asymptotic normality for the estimator are
investigated, and it is proved that the adaptive LASSO estimator has
the oracle properties. The proposed method can be easily
implemented. Finally a Monte Carlo simulation study is conducted to
assess the finite sample performance of the proposed variable
selection procedure, results show the adaptive LASSO estimator
behaves well. 相似文献
